July Weather in Pantukan, Philippines

Last updated: August 27, 2025

In Pantukan, Philippines, the average temperature in July is a pleasant 25°C (78°F). You can expect minimum temperatures of 21°C (71°F) and maximums reaching 31°C (89°F). With an average precipitation of 400 mm (15.7 in) spread over 23 days, it's wise to carry an umbrella. The climate is also quite humid, with an average humidity level of 82%.

How July Weather in Pantukan Compares to Other Months

Weather in Pantukan varies notably across the year, with each month offering distinct climate conditions. This page compares July’s weather to other months in Pantukan, focusing on differences in temperature, rainfall, humidity, and UV levels.

This table compares monthly weather conditions in Pantukan, showing how July’s temperature, precipitation, humidity, and UV index levels differ from those of other months.
 TemperaturePrecipitationHumidityUV
January Weather24°C (76°F)496 mm (19.5 inches)90%extreme
February Weather24°C (76°F)374 mm (14.7 inches)92%extreme
March Weather25°C (77°F)462 mm (18.2 inches)90%extreme
April Weather25°C (78°F)415 mm (16.3 inches)87%extreme
May Weather26°C (78°F)614 mm (24.2 inches)83%extreme
June Weather25°C (78°F)519 mm (20.4 inches)83%extreme
July Weather25°C (78°F)400 mm (15.7 inches)82%extreme
August Weather25°C (78°F)325 mm (12.8 inches)83%extreme
September Weather25°C (78°F)326 mm (12.8 inches)85%extreme
October Weather25°C (78°F)405 mm (15.9 inches)82%extreme
November Weather25°C (77°F)472 mm (18.6 inches)83%extreme
December Weather25°C (77°F)467 mm (18.4 inches)87%extreme
